Toyota Industries Corporation, traded over-the-counter under the ticker symbol TYIDF, is a diversified Japanese company known primarily for its production of vehicles and industrial equipment. Established in 1926 as a division of the Toyota Group, the corporation plays a significant role in the automotive supply chain, specializing in material handling equipment, logistics, and textile machinery.
One of the main business segments of Toyota Industries is its manufacturing of forklifts and other material handling equipment through its Toyota Material Handling division. This sector has benefited from the growing demand for efficient logistics and warehousing solutions, driven by e-commerce developments and global supply chain complexities. Toyota Industries holds a reputable position in the global market, leveraging advanced engineering and sustainability initiatives to enhance productivity and minimize environmental impact.
In addition to material handling, Toyota Industries is involved in the production of automotive components such as engines, HVAC systems, and electronic systems. The firm supplies parts to Toyota Motor Corporation and other automakers, positioning itself as an integral supporter of the automotive industry. The ongoing shift towards electric vehicles (EVs) and hybrid technology presents both challenges and opportunities for the corporation, as it adapts to new industry standards and consumer preferences.

Toyota Industries Corp is primarily engaged in manufacturing and sale of automobiles, industrial vehicles, and textile machinery, as well as logistics business. The company manufactures and sells automobiles, engines, foundry pieces and electronic equipment. It also provides forklift trucks, warehouse equipment, automatic warehouse, vehicles for high-place work. In addition, it also engaged in the land transportation service, collection, and delivery service. The business of the group is primarily functioned through Japan and its amplifying internationally.
